Talking to one of my favourite folk musicians!

I first met Ronan Kealy (Junior Brother’s real name) at the event Merchy Christmas in The Grand Social pub and concert venue in Dublin. I knew two of his songs at the time (‘The Men Who Eat Ringforts‘ and ‘Take Guilt‘), and was not affiliated with his albums. We spoke briefly at his merchandise stand and I bought a t-shirt that said ‘I Am Junior Brother’s Favourite’, referencing his EP called ‘Junior Brother’s Favourite‘. Since then, I have been a fan of his music and I have adored listening to songs he made on his first album such as ‘Coping’, as well as new songs recorded for his new album ‘The End‘ such as ‘Plague Medal’, which we discuss in the interview.

Logan Sounds Off and Junior Brother

In the interview, Ronan and I discuss many different topics regarding his music, including his inspirations and the first music he played with his secondary school band, as well as his very early demo recordings released on Bandcamp called ‘The Slane Is Gone‘.

As a fan and also as an interviewer, I loved talking to Ronan as he is such an interesting musician who writes some inspiring songs. He blends genres such as traditional Irish music, folk music as well as rock music.
